Drain valve repair services involve fixing or replacing valves that control the release of water or other fluids from plumbing systems. These valves are essential components in residential and commercial properties, allowing for the safe and efficient draining of tanks, boilers, or appliances. When a drain valve malfunctions, it can lead to leaks, water wastage, or difficulty in draining systems properly. Skilled service providers can diagnose issues, repair damaged valves, or install new ones to ensure your plumbing functions smoothly and reliably.
Problems with drain valves often manifest as persistent leaks, inability to drain systems fully, or unexpected water loss. Leaking valves can cause water damage over time, promote mold growth, or increase utility bills. In some cases, a valve may become stuck or corroded, preventing proper operation.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more serious plumbing failures and maintain the integrity of your property's plumbing infrastructure. The overview below groups typical Drain Valve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Baltimore,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or drain valve repairs in Baltimore and nearby areas range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the specific issue and accessibility. Fewer projects tend to push into higher cost brackets.
Part Replacement - Replacing a drain valve or its components usually costs between $300 and $800. Local contractors often perform these repairs within this range, with larger or more complex replacements potentially reaching $1,200 or more.
Full Drain Valve Replacement - Complete replacement of a drain valve can range from $600 to $1,500 for most residential or commercial properties. Larger or more intricate installations in Baltimore may exceed this, especially if additional plumbing work is needed.
Major Repair or System Overhaul - Extensive repairs or system overhauls in the area can cost from $2,000 to $5,000 or higher. These projects are less common and usually involve significant labor and parts, with most projects falling into the lower to mid-range brackets.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a drain valve needs repair? Signs include persistent leaks, reduced drainage efficiency, or unusual noises during operation, indicating that a repair may be necessary.
How do local contractors typically repair drain valves? They inspect the valve for damage or wear, replace faulty components, and ensure proper sealing to prevent leaks and ensure smooth operation.
Can drain valve repairs be done without replacing the entire unit? Yes, many repairs involve fixing or replacing specific parts, which can often restore the valve's functionality without full replacement.
